一、服务网格架构下的认证痛点剖析
美国VPS托管的Windows容器集群在服务网格架构中常面临三重复合挑战。第一维度来自混合云环境的地理隔离特性,跨国数据中心间的服务通信需要满足严格的CJIS(刑事司法信息服务)合规标准。第二维度涉及Windows容器特有的身份认证机制,传统Kerberos协议在微服务高频交互场景下存在性能瓶颈。第三维度则是零知识证明在x86架构下的硬件加速需求,特别是当服务网格中Istio组件需要处理大规模ZK-SNARKs(简洁非交互式零知识证明)运算时。如何在保障身份真实性的同时实现低延迟验证,成为服务网格优化的关键突破口。
二、零知识证明在容器认证中的技术适配
Windows容器的NTFS虚拟化层为ZKP实施创造了独特的技术条件。基于Fabric服务网格的实验数据显示,采用Bulletproofs算法进行身份凭证隐藏时,单次验证耗时可缩短至28ms,相较传统JWT验证效率提升17%。在具体配置中,需特别注意三点:第一,Hyper-V隔离模式下的TEE(可信执行环境)与ZKP验证链的兼容设置;第二,美国FIPS 140-2标准对椭圆曲线参数的特殊要求;第三,服务网格Envoy代理的gRPC流与证明生成的异步协调机制。这种技术组合使得即使在高频服务调用场景下,认证系统也能保持1.2秒级的端到端响应时效。
三、合规导向的认证体系构建路径
针对美国司法管辖区的特殊要求,认证方案需要实现三层次合规保障。基础层采用NIST认证的SHA-3算法构建承诺函数,中间层通过零知识状态通道满足CFAA(计算机欺诈和滥用法案)的审计要求,应用层则依托服务网格的mTLS(双向TLS)实现自动化策略分发。实践中发现,将Cilium网络策略与ZKP验证器集成后,可降低32%的合规审计工作量。关键配置点包括:Windows Defender Credential Guard的隔离内存管理、Azure Arc混合云控制平面的策略同步,以及服务网格的渐进式证书轮换机制。
四、性能优化与资源分配策略
在资源受限的美国VPS环境中,采用分级证明验证架构可显著降低计算开销。基准测试表明,将ZK-SNARKs证明分片处理并部署到3节点Nomad集群后,CPU使用率下降41%,同时保持99.98%的请求成功率。具体优化手段包括:利用Windows容器Host Compute Service的GPU虚拟化功能加速证明生成;通过服务网格的流量镜像功能实施灰度验证;构建基于Rust语言的WASM过滤器实现边缘节点预处理。这种架构使得单个m4.large实例可承载1200+ TPS的认证吞吐量,完全满足中等规模企业级应用需求。
五、攻防场景下的安全增强实践
零知识认证体系的防御效果在模拟渗透测试中得到充分验证。相较于传统OAuth 2.0方案,ZKP体系可有效防御三类新型攻击:服务网格东西向流量的重放攻击、Windows容器令牌注入攻击,以及针对gMSA(组托管服务账户)的凭据窃取攻击。防御增强的关键在于三点机制:利用零知识特性隐藏服务身份元数据;基于可信时间源的动态证明有效窗口控制;服务网格sidecar代理的活性检测协议。实际部署中,将证明验证与Falco运行时安全监控系统联动,可实现对可疑调用的200ms级快速响应。
通过服务网格架构与零知识证明的创新融合,Windows容器在美国VPS环境中的安全边界得到本质性扩展。该方案不仅满足HIPAA和FedRAMP等严苛合规要求,更通过算法优化使认证系统的资源消耗降低至可工程化水平。随着量子计算威胁的临近,这种融合零信任架构的认证体系将持续释放其技术潜力,为分布式系统安全提供全新范式。